Improving RG4 Installation for Maximum Signal Integrity

Achieving optimal signal integrity in RG4 installations requires careful consideration of several factors during the installation process. For maximizing this, it is crucial to select high-quality RG4 cable with low attenuation and minimal impedance variations. Moreover, proper termination techniques are essential for minimizing signal reflections and ensuring a clean transmission path. Take meticulous care factors such as connector type, crimping technique, and shielding effectiveness to minimize the impact of electromagnetic interference (EMI).

  • Utilizing proper grounding techniques can significantly improve signal integrity by eliminating ground loops and noise coupling.
  • Directing RG4 cable at a distance from sources of electromagnetic interference, such as power lines and motors, can also minimize signal degradation.
  • Periodically inspecting RG4 installations for signs of damage or deterioration is crucial to ensure long-term signal integrity.

Troubleshooting Common Issues with RG4 Cable Connections

When connecting your gadgets with an RG4 cable, you might encounter some problems. Don't worry! These issues are often easily fixed.

Here are some common RG4 cable connection issues and where to troubleshoot them:

* **Loose Connections:** A flaky connection is a common culprit.

Verify the connectors are tightly plugged into both the equipment.

* **Damaged Cable:** Inspect the cable for obvious wear and tear, such as breaks. A damaged cable needs to be swapped for a new one.

* **Signal Interference:** Other signals can disrupt the RG4 signal. Try shifting your devices to reduce interference.

* **Incompatible Connectors:** Check that both the equipment and the cable have compatible connectors.

Keep in mind that if you've made an effort these troubleshooting solutions and are still having problems, it's best to contact a qualified professional.
